Default Alpha 1- closed cooling ?

The upper housing on my Mecury alpha 1 outdrive gets very hot
to the touch when on the hose at home. Have not checked out on the water due to the swim platform. I have a full system, freshwater-closed system.
It has been explained to me but also some conflicting responses when I asked if the lower unit has an active or inactive impeller/water pump. The water for the heat exchanger comes in throgh a supply pump drawing through the hull.
Can anyone clear this up for me? P.S. Water does come out a weep hole at the bottom of the drive. Is the heat from a bad bearing or normal?

What you are describing is normal. There is exhaust flowing thru the upper housing. When in the water the water serves as a heat synch. They make drive showers for high performance applications to cool the upper gearcase when underway. However they aren't needed for stock applications.
